Hey guys,
I run an LCX-111c HD off of an LGC-4000 puck. The other night, it would not acquire my position and I kept getting 'GPS Module Not Responding'.

So, I started looking over the unit, and noticed the 'Network' cable had a segment that was severed. So, looks like I found the problem with that.

Question is, does anyone have any experience replacing this particular cable and where I could find one? I have been in touch with Lowrance, and they have been absolutely no help. I suppose since it is an older unit, they no longer offer support for it.

I am hoping it's as easy as tracking down a new cable and swapping it out of the T-adapter, but it doesn't look that easy.

Before you buy a new one try cutting back the insulation an splice the wires that are cut. I'm pretty sure that puck only has 4 wires in it. Solider the wires and heat shrink or e tape them and give it a go. If it works ride it out til you find a replacement
